Understanding PKU and Why It Qualifies as a Specialty Diet

PKU occurs when the enzyme phenylalanine hydroxylase cannot convert the amino acid phenylalanine into tyrosine. The result is a buildup of phenylalanine in the blood, which can damage the developing brain. Untreated PKU leads to intellectual disability, seizures, behavioral problems, and mental disorders (Wikipedia). Because the condition is genetic and lifelong, the dietary approach is classified as a specialty diet rather than a temporary regimen.

In my experience, the first breakthrough for families is realizing that the diet is not about “restriction” but about substitution. We replace high-phenylalanine foods - like regular milk, cheese, meat, and many grains - with specially formulated low-phenylalanine alternatives. The diet also incorporates medical foods, such as phenylalanine-free protein substitutes, to meet protein needs without raising blood levels.

Key distinctions of the PKU diet include:

  • Strict daily phenylalanine limits based on age, weight, and blood-phenylalanine targets.
  • Use of a phenylalanine-free amino acid formula for infants and children.
  • Regular blood monitoring to adjust dietary allowances.

Understanding the science behind PKU helps families accept the diet as a protective measure rather than a punitive one. The goal is to maintain blood phenylalanine within a target range (usually 2-6 mg/dL for children) while ensuring growth, energy, and psychosocial wellbeing.


Implementing the Low-Phenylalanine Diet: Foods, Formulas, and Supplements

When I design a meal plan, I start with the phenylalanine allowance for the day. For a typical 7-kg toddler, the limit might be around 250 mg of phenylalanine, which translates to about 1 g of protein from natural foods. All other protein comes from a phenylalanine-free medical formula.

Infants with PKU rely almost entirely on a specialized formula. Wikipedia notes that babies should use a special formula with a small amount of phenylalanine. The formula provides all essential amino acids except phenylalanine, plus vitamins and minerals. I counsel parents on preparing the formula correctly, storing it safely, and gradually introducing solid foods at six months.

Supplements are another pillar. Many patients take a phenylalanine-free amino acid mix to cover the remainder of their protein needs. I also monitor vitamin D, calcium, and omega-3 intake because the diet can be low in these nutrients.

Scheduling is critical. I recommend a daily log that tracks:

  • Formula volume (mL)
  • Phenylalanine-containing foods (grams)
  • Blood phenylalanine level (mg/dL)
  • Physical activity and energy needs

Many families use smartphone apps designed for metabolic disorders. The app sends reminders for formula feeds and prompts a quick entry after each meal. Over a six-month period, families who adopted the logging habit reduced the number of out-of-range blood tests by nearly half.

My advice for parents of teenagers is to involve the teen in meal planning. Let them choose PKU-friendly recipes from reputable cookbooks. This autonomy improves adherence and reduces conflict during the inevitable “I’m bored of the same foods” phase.

Frequently Asked Questions

Q: How often should blood phenylalanine be tested?

A: For infants, testing is usually weekly until stable, then monthly. Children and adolescents typically have tests every 1-3 months, while adults may test every 3-6 months, adjusting frequency based on diet changes or illness.

Q: Can someone with PKU eat regular cheese or milk?

A: Regular dairy products contain high phenylalanine and are not recommended. Low-protein or phenylalanine-free cheese alternatives, often made from soy or whey-free isolates, are safe substitutes when used within the daily allowance.

Q: Are there any plant-based snacks that fit the PKU diet?

A: Yes. Many plant-based snacks can be modified to reduce phenylalanine, such as low-protein rice cakes, fruit leathers, and custom energy gels made from maltodextrin and electrolytes. Always check the phenylalanine content or create your own using a phenylalanine-free base.

Q: How does the PKU diet affect growth in children?

A: When properly balanced with a phenylalanine-free formula and adequate calories, children with PKU grow at rates comparable to their peers. Regular monitoring of weight, height, and nutrient status is essential to adjust the diet as needed.

Q: Can adults with PKU still enjoy social meals?

A: Absolutely. Adults can plan ahead by bringing low-phenylalanine dishes, using phenylalanine-free protein powders in smoothies, and selecting restaurant items that are naturally low in protein (e.g., salads without cheese or nuts). Communication with the host and having a backup snack ensures adherence without feeling isolated.
